Welcome to Skjulsta Cafe, a charming escape nestled along the tranquil Skjulsta stream in Eskilstuna, Sweden. This delightful cafe radiates a warm and inviting atmosphere, reminiscent of a cozy lakeside retreat, making it an ideal destination for anyone seeking a peaceful break from daily routines.

As you step into Skjulsta Cafe, you are enveloped by the scent of freshly brewed coffee mingling with the soft sounds of nature. The decor echoes a nostalgic charm, reminiscent of the 1960s, bringing a touch of history and warmth to your experience. With ample seating both inside and outside, patrons have the choice to bask in the serene views of the stream or enjoy their meal surrounded by nature on delightful picnic tables. You'll find that a cozy blanket can enhance your outdoor experience, especially as you take in the beauty surrounding you.

On the menu, Skjulsta Cafe offers a selection of simple yet satisfying options that align perfectly with its peaceful ethos. Patrons rave about the coffee, which is perfectly brewed to awaken your senses and pair beautifully with some deliciously crafted pastries and lighter lunch fare. Ideal for a casual afternoon break, each dish is prepared with care, making the experience feel homey and personal.

What sets Skjulsta Cafe apart is not only its comforting offerings but the unique environment in which you can enjoy them. Customers like Marianne Storm describe it as a “mysigt äldre sportstugekaffe,” reflecting the cafe's cozy, community-focused atmosphere. On their visit, they enjoyed a relaxing day, noting it as “just what is needed by the beach.” Whether you're enjoying a slice of cake or sipping coffee while watching the river flow, the spot feels just right.

Sandeep H Das captures another charming aspect of this cafe, highlighting the lovely interior and the beautiful river view, especially from the window tables. He mentions the delightful opportunity to ooh and ahh over the local wildlife, as you may spot the elusive strömstare, or white-throated dipper, diving gracefully into the stream. What more could one ask for than a cozy cafe with a view, a good book, and the gentle sounds of nature?

For those planning to visit, parking is conveniently available just before the bridge, ensuring easy access to this hidden gem. A cosy cafe on the bank of the Skjulsta stream. Lots of place to sure inside. Try to get the window table for a nice view of the river. The fireplace was not burning when I visited. Parking is just before the bridge, on the left. Don't forget to spot the strömstare (white throated dipper) as it dives into the water to catch insects. You can watch them from the bridge.
